In 2020, Asahi Broadcasting Group Holdings Corporation deployed Avid Pro Tools Video Satellite in its MA room upgrade in Osaka as part of a Video Editing implementation for broadcast post-production. The Avid Pro Tools Video Satellite configuration was used to synchronize Media Composer playback with Pro Tools, creating coordinated audio and video timelines for routine edit and mix review sessions.
The deployment enabled dual Pro Tools configurations and established file-based networked workflows, aligning multitrack audio mixing with sequence playback and supporting immersive audio formats for broadcast delivery. This broadcast MA implementation improved system redundancy through redundant playback paths, simplified synchronized video and audio playback for post-production operations, and centralized playback orchestration between Media Composer and Avid Pro Tools.

In 2023, Exa International Japan implemented Avid Pro Tools Video Satellite as the video system in its MA facility, deploying the application within a Video Editing workflow alongside Pro Tools and an Avid S6 control surface. Avid Pro Tools Video Satellite provides synchronized 4K preview and playback during audio-for-picture sessions, integrating with the installed Pro Tools digital audio workstation and the Avid S6 console to align picture reference with multitrack audio playback.
The deployment supports MA and narration workflows in Tokyo and extends operational coverage to client-facing remote review, enabling high-quality 4K previews and remote client checks for post-production projects. Functional capabilities implemented include synchronized video monitoring for audio-for-picture, coordinated 4K playback orchestration for session review, and real-time client preview workflows, positioning Exa International Japan Avid Pro Tools Video Satellite to serve post-production and audio-for-picture business functions within the Video Editing category.

In 2021, The Tube Japan deployed Avid Pro Tools Video Satellite to enable synchronized video preview from shared Facilis storage for its Pro Tools-based MA and video editing workflows. The Avid Pro Tools Video Satellite implementation provided low-latency online playback directly from the Facilis shared storage pool, removing the need for local file copying during edit sessions and preserving frame-accurate playback within native Pro Tools timelines. The deployment emphasized real-time preview orchestration and timeline alignment to support concurrent editorial and MA tasks.
Deployment covered multiple Tokyo sites and centralized media access for post-production and MA teams, reducing local data duplication during edit and MA work. Functional scope included synchronized preview and playback coordination, shared storage access for Video Editing workflows, and playback orchestration via Avid Pro Tools Video Satellite integrated with Pro Tools and Facilis storage. The Tube Japan observed improved post-production turnaround across its sites following the implementation.
